Creating a sophisticated look with minimalist pieces is about focusing on quality over quantity and letting simplicity speak volumes.
Start by investing in well-tailored basics that fit your body perfectly.
The core of a minimalist wardrobe rests on a white button-down, tailored high-waisted trousers, and a structured blazer in subtle neutrals like taupe, deep navy, or soft gray.
These items should be made from natural fabrics such as cotton, wool, or silk, as they drape better and age gracefully.
Color is your quiet ally.
Anchor your look in muted tones: black, ivory, slate, beige, and warm taupe.
They blend seamlessly, creating cohesion while highlighting individual garments.
If you want to add subtle interest, choose one item with a refined texture, like a cashmere sweater or veste stone island homme a linen blend coat.
Texture adds depth without clutter.
Jewelry and accents must serve purpose, not spectacle.
One fine chain, a slim belt in supple leather, or simple geometric studs are all you need.
Avoid loud logos or excessive jewelry.
True polish comes from omission, not addition.
Never underestimate how footwear anchors your entire aesthetic.
Opt for clean lines and timeless silhouettes—pointed toe flats, loafers, or low block heels in black or brown leather.
They should be comfortable enough to wear all day but polished enough to feel intentional.
Layering is key to adding dimension.
Layer a ribbed crewneck under a longline trench, or a silk camisole beneath an unstructured jacket.
Avoid oversized or bulky fabrics—precision is paramount.
Your presence completes the look.
Neat hair, trimmed nails, and upright posture are the invisible hallmarks of refined taste.
Minimalism doesn’t mean bare—it means thoughtful.
Each piece must be functional, comfortable, and aligned with your quiet confidence.
When done right, less truly becomes more.
